Quick reminder for anyone covering the desk: visitors heading to the Kestrel hardware lab on level 2 must be walked in by a Brightvale staff member — no exceptions, even for regulars from Oakmere Systems. Have them sign the lab log, hand over a pair of safety glasses, and remind them not to touch anything on the rework benches. If the escort hasn't arrived, visitors wait at the desk. Escorts should enter the lab using the code below.

door code, yagap-bahof: bdg-O-05

# GateTally turnstile counter — prod env for Vexhall Stadium rollout.
# Counts per-gate entries, pushes totals to the Crowdline dashboard every 5s.
# Release notes: v2.3 drops the legacy pulse decoder; gates 1-4 now use the
# optical tick sensor. Do not ship without confirming the Crowdline ingest
# endpoint is on the new region. Rotation happens at each season boundary,
# not per release. Ops owns the counter reset schedule.
# The ingest auth secret goes on the next line.

vault entry, yahif-yajep: COURIER_KEY29=b802bdf8034096b65a51c6ba5abe2

### Step 14 — Verify Replica Lag Alarm Before Sealing Keys

Before the Korvane key ceremony proceeds, confirm the read-replica lag alarm on the Pellwood cluster is green and has fired a test alert within the last hour. If the alarm panel is locked out, the ceremony officiant must unlock it using the recovery passphrase, which follows directly below.

unlock words, yawig-kagef: gordor-holvan-ulaael-pramir-ulaiel-tamdor

[ ] Confirm the stale-cache fix from the Brindlemoor digest incident actually shipped. Quick recap for future folks: the Oakspur cache layer kept serving week-old pricing because the invalidation hook fired before the write committed. We reordered it and added a TTL backstop, but please eyeball the cache hit metrics for a day after release anyway. The exact build that carries the fix is noted right below this item.

trace token, fafog-kageg: htk4_98e6

**Vendor note: Inkmill markdown pipeline**

Rendering for Parchway docs is outsourced to Inkmill under an annual contract, renewing each March. They handle sanitization and PDF export; we own the upload queue. SLA: 4-hour response on rendering failures. Escalate only after two failed retries. Their support desk is reachable at the address below.

billing contact of hahaf-baguf = zorael.tammir.jorius@sivrelhq.internal